Teletext Feature
Most television stations provide written information services via Teletext. The index page of the Teletext service gives you information 
on how to use the service. In addition, you can select various options to suit your requirements by using the remote control buttons.
For Teletext information to be displayed correctly, channel reception must be stable. Otherwise, information may be missing or some 
pages may not be displayed.

Teletext information is often divided between several pages displayed in sequence, which can 
be accessed by:
Entering the page number
Selecting a title in a list
Selecting a coloured heading (FASTEXT system)
Teletext level supported by the TV is version 2.5 which is capable of displaying additional 
graphics or text. 
Depending upon the transmission, blank side panels can occur when displaying Teletext. 
In these cases, additional graphics or text is not transmitted. 
Older TV’s which do not support version 2.5 are not capable of displaying any additional 
graphics or text, regardless of the Teletext transmission.
